John Singer Sargent

John Singer Sargent stands as one of the most celebrated American expatriate artists of the late nineteenth and early twentieth centuries, widely regarded as the defining portraitist of the Gilded Age. Born in Florence in 1856 to American parents, he was immersed in European culture from birth, training under the French master Carolus-Duran in Paris before eventually settling in London. His style masterfully bridges Impressionism and Realism, characterized by breathtaking technical virtuosity, loose yet confident brushwork, and an extraordinary ability to capture light, texture, and personality in a single fleeting moment. What truly sets Sargent apart is his gift for psychological depth — his subjects feel alive, caught mid-breath, as though they might step out of the frame at any moment.

Among his most iconic oil paintings on canvas are the scandalous and groundbreaking Portrait of Madame X, the luminous and atmospheric Carnation, Lily, Lily, Rose, and the hauntingly intimate El Jaleo, a monumental depiction of Spanish dancers that showcases his unrivaled command of movement and drama. His watercolors and mural commissions at the Boston Public Library further demonstrate the astonishing range of John Singer Sargent's artistic ambition. Throughout his prolific career, he produced hundreds of portraits for the European and American elite, each one a testament to his ability to translate social grandeur into deeply personal human expression, cementing his legacy as one of the greatest figurative painters in Western art history.
